Web Application for Student Evaluation & Power BI Reporting

Overview

St. Joseph Institute for the Deaf (SJID), a pioneering educational institution for students with hearing disabilities, relied on Excel spreadsheets to manage evaluations, enrollments, and student progress. This manual process was time-consuming, inefficient, and prone to errors. Rare Crew partnered with SJID to take them to the next level of digitalization by delivering a fully integrated web application and real-time Power BI reports.
From initial discussions through research, analysis, UX design, and development, Rare Crew led the full cycle of the project and continues to provide ongoing support and system updates.

 

Challenges

Before adopting the Rare Crew solution, SJID faced several operational challenges:

  • Manual Data Entry & Tracking: All evaluations were recorded in spreadsheets, leading to duplication, data loss, and limited access to student histories.
  • Disconnected Enrollment Processes: No centralized platform to manage student enrollment into multiple programs and classes across locations.
  • Delayed Insights: Reporting for student progress, program effectiveness, and institutional trends required manual compilation and lacked depth.
  • Scattered Systems: No integration across student information, evaluation scores, and administrative activities.

 

Our Solution

Rare Crew delivered a custom digital platform that centralized student evaluation, streamlined program management, and introduced powerful data visualization through Power BI.

1. Full-Cycle Project Execution

  • Initial Consultation & Discovery: Close collaboration with SJID stakeholders to understand challenges and objectives.
  • Research & Requirements Gathering: Deep dive into SJID’s evaluation processes and compliance needs.
  • UX/UI Design: Intuitive, accessible interface designed with educators and administrators in mind.
  • Custom Development: A secure, responsive web application tailored to SJID’s workflows and educational goals.
  • Ongoing Support: Post-launch maintenance, updates, and helpdesk support to ensure smooth operations and feature scalability.

 

2. Comprehensive Student & Evaluation Management

  • Student Profiles: Detailed student records, including demographics, hearing technology, and enrollment history.
  • Evaluation Wizard: Step-by-step form to enter structured assessment data across multiple domains.
  • Permanent Data Storage: Evaluations are stored long-term and available for historical analysis.

 

3. Dynamic Program and Enrollment Management

  • Multi-State Program Support: Easily add/edit/delete programs and classes per location.
  • Flexible Enrollment Options: Assign students to multiple programs/classes with discharge tracking.

 

4. Secure Role-Based Access

  • Microsoft Active Directory Integration: Single sign-on with secure user provisioning.
  • Role Management: Different views and access rights for administrators and teachers.

 

5. Real-Time Power BI Reports

  • Automated Data Sync: Continuous export of relevant data points to Power BI.
  • Insightful Dashboards: Track progress by student, program, or class with filters and interactive visuals.
  • Custom Report Capability: Power BI templates provided, with the ability to expand as needs evolve.

 

 

Results & Impact

The Rare Crew solution transformed SJID’s operations, replacing fragmented workflows with a streamlined digital system:

  • 100% Elimination of Excel-Based Processes
  • Faster Evaluation & Enrollment Workflows
  • Improved Accuracy & Data Integrity
  • Real-Time Data-Driven Insights via Power BI
  • Enhanced Collaboration Between Staff Roles
  • Ongoing System Support Ensures Scalability and Flexibility

 

Conclusion

By taking ownership of the full project cycle — from consultation to deployment and support — Rare Crew helped St. Joseph Institute for the Deaf undergo a true digital transformation. The web application and integrated reporting tools empower educators to make faster, smarter decisions and focus on what matters most: student development.

Want to hear more from the client themselves? Read the review on Clutch.

Ready to move beyond spreadsheets? Let’s explore how Rare Crew can support your mission with custom digital solutions.

Let’s talk!

Related Articles

How Can Custom Mobile App Development Help Different Industries?

A custom mobile app can provide industry-specific solutions that cater to your company's unique dema...

Techreviewer: Rare Crew One of Top Software Developers in the USA

Rare Crew has been recognized by software reviewer Techreviewer as a top software development compan...

One Of Slovakia’s Most Reviewed Software Developers For 2023

Discover Rare Crew, a top-ranked Slovakian software developer in 2023, acclaimed for expertise and c...

Cookie Settings

×

When you visit any website, it may store or retrieve information on your browser in the form of cookies. This information may be about you, your preferences or your device. This is mostly used to make the website work as you would expect it to. The information doesn’t identify you but can be used to offer a more personalized web experience.

Because we respect your right to privacy, you can choose to not allow certain types of cookies. By clicking on the different category headings, you can find out more and change from our default settings. However, blocking certain types of cookies may negatively impact your experience on this site and the services we are able to offer.

Cookie Policy

Manage Consent Preferences

These cookies are necessary for the website to be able to function, hence cannot be switched off in our systems. They are usually only set in response to actions made by you which amount to a request for services. This includes setting your privacy preferences, logging in or filling in forms. You can set up your browser to block or alert you about these cookies, however some parts of the website won’t work as a result. These cookies don’t store any personally identifiable information.

These cookies allow us to count visits and traffic sources, so we can measure and improve the performance of our site. They help us know which pages are the most and least popular and see how visitors move around the site. All information these cookies collect is aggregated and therefore anonymous. If you do not allow these cookies, we will not know when you have visited our site.

These cookies may be set through our site by our advertising partners. They may be used by those companies to build a profile of your interests and show you relevant adverts on other sites.    They do not store directly personal information, but are based on uniquely identifying your browser and internet device. If you do not allow these cookies, you will experience less targeted advertising.